What you’ll need

Here’s everything you need to make this delectable dish:

  • 1 lb Cajun-seasoned steak tips
  • 8 oz rigatoni pasta
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 1 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 2 tbsp butter
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Chopped parsley for garnish

Feel free to swap in different pastas like penne or fusilli if you have those on hand. The Cajun steak really shines, so ensure you’re using a quality cut for the best results.

Step-by-step instructions

Cooking method

  1. Begin by cooking the rigatoni according to the package instructions. Once al dente, drain it and set aside.
  2. In a large skillet,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and sauté until fragrant, about 1-2 minutes.
  3. Add the Cajun-seasoned steak tips to the skillet. Cook until they’re nicely browned and cooked to your preference, stirring occasionally.
  4. Reduce the heat to low and stir in the heavy cream and grated Parmesan cheese. Mix until the cheese melts and the sauce becomes creamy.
  5. Toss the cooked rigatoni into the skillet, making sure it is well coated with the delicious sauce.
  6. Season with salt and pepper to your taste.
  7. Serve hot, garnished with chopped parsley for a pop of color.

How to store

This dish is best enjoyed fresh, but if you have leftovers, they can easily be stored. Place the cooled Cajun Steak Tips with Cheesy Rigatoni in an airtight container and refrigerate. It will last up to 3-4 days. For longer storage, consider freezing it. Just remember to thaw it safely in the refrigerator before reheating it in a skillet over low heat, stirring occasionally, until heated through.

Helpful cooking tips

Here are a few tips to ensure your dish turns out perfectly:

  • For added depth of flavor, marinate the steak tips in Cajun seasoning for a few hours, or even overnight.
  • If you prefer a spicier kick, consider using hot Cajun seasoning or adding a pinch of cayenne pepper.
  • Cooking the pasta just until al dente is crucial as it will continue to cook slightly when mixed with the sauce.

Creative twists

Feel free to experiment with different toppings and flavors! You could incorporate sautéed mushrooms or bell peppers alongside the steak for extra texture. For a lighter version, try swapping heavy cream with a mixture of Greek yogurt and a splash of pasta water. And for those who prefer a vegetarian option, replace steak tips with seasoned tofu or chickpeas.

Your questions answered

What is the prep time for Cajun Steak Tips with Cheesy Rigatoni?

Prep time is about 10 minutes, while cooking takes approximately 20 minutes. In under 30 minutes, you can have this delicious meal on your table!

Can I freeze leftovers?

Yes, you can freeze this dish. Just ensure it’s in an airtight container to prevent freezer burn. It’s best consumed within three months.

What can I substitute for Parmesan cheese?

If you don’t have Parmesan cheese on hand, Pecorino Romano or even nutritional yeast for a dairy-free option can work well and bring a similar cheesy flavor.
